- N +

pod生命周期证书(ipd生命周期阶段主要活动)

pod生命周期证书(ipd生命周期阶段主要活动)原标题:pod生命周期证书(ipd生命周期阶段主要活动)

导读:

K8S会是基础架构的未来吗?因此,K8S是基础架构未来的关键组成部分,但需根据具体需求灵活应用。Kubernetes(k8s)的角色定位起源与适配:k8s因Docker而生,...

k8s会是基础架构未来吗?

因此,K8S是基础架构未来的关键组成部分,但需根据具体需求灵活应用

Kubernetes(k8s)的角色定位起源与适配:k8s因docker而生,天然适配微服务场景Docker轻量级特性与微服务高度契合)。其核心容器编排,而非专为微服务设计基础设施抽象:类比IDC:k8s像机房管理员,负责容器(物理服务器)的部署网络配置等。

综上所述,k8s(kubernetes)和Openstack在未来可能继续企业云和数据中心中互补共存,而不是简单的取代关系

Node工作负载异常,一部分Pod状态为Terminating

1、总结:当node工作负载异常,一部分pod状态为Terminating时,应首先检查节点状态和集群资源情况然后尝试使用自动手动方法删除Terminating状态的POD。同时,考虑优化发布策略减少服务中断的风险

2、Pod删除过程中,如果节点异常,Kubernetes会通过kube-controller-manager和kubelet的驱逐机制调整工作负载。kube-controller-manager负责大范围驱逐,而kubelet则处理细粒度的资源管理。Terminating状态的Pod,可以通过kubectl命令删除,或在资源压力下,kubelet直接驱逐。

3、pod可能运行因为某种原因发生故障的节点。

4、Pod 处于 Terminating 或 Unknown 状态原因及排查方法:Node 失联:从 v5 开始,KuberNETes 不会因为 Node 失联而自动删除其上正在运行的 Pod。需要手动删除失联的 Node,或等待 Node 恢复正常

5、分析如下:Node状态与Pod调度:在Kubernetes中,如果运行Pod的Node节点(包括master节点,尽管通常master节点不运行Pod,但在某些配置下可能会)发生故障,如宕机、网络异常等,Kubernetes会将该Node标记为NotReady状态。此时,Kubernetes的调度器会尝试在其他可用的Node节点上重新调度这些Pod,以实现高可用性。

k8s的概念与架构介绍

k8s的核心概念 Kubernetes 的核心概念主要包括 Pod、Service、NamespacedeploymentStatefulSetDaemonSet、Job 和 CronJob 等。Pod Pod 是 Kubernetes 中最小的调度和管理单元代表集群中运行的一个多个容器实例

K8s架构与组件详解K8s架构K8s(Kubernetes)系统在设计时遵循c-s(客户端-服务器)架构,其核心组件之间交互主要围绕APIServer进行。在生产环境中,为了实现K8s系统服务的高可用性,通常会部署多个Master节点。K8s集群至少包含一个工作节点(Node),这些节点上运行着由K8s管理的容器化应用。

Kubernetes 是一个基于容器技术分布式架构解决方案,是 google 开源的一个容器集群管理系统简称 K8S。Kubernetes 的基本概念Kubernetes 是一个开源的容器编排和管理平台,它允许用户自动化地部署、扩展和管理容器化应用程序

基本概念:K3s:是Kubernetes的轻量版本,专为在资源有限的边缘计算设备上运行而设计。K8s:即标准Kubernetes版本,是业界广泛使用的容器编排平台。架构差异:K3s:高度简化和轻量级,减少了资源占用,同时保持了Kubernetes的核心功能。K8s:提供全面的功能和强大的扩展性,适用于规模集群和企业级应用。

Pod生命周期

1、Pod生命周期是指Pod对象创建至终止的这段时间范围内所经历的一系列过程和状态变化。它主要包括Pod的创建过程、运行过程(包括初始化容器、主容器、容器启动钩子和容器终止前钩子)、容器探测存活性探测和就绪性探测)以及Pod的终止过程。

2、Pod是Kubernetes中最小的可部署计算单元,它封装了一个或多个容器以及这些容器的一些共享资源。Pod的生命周期从创建开始,经历运行、更新、终止等阶段,直到最终被删除。

3、Pod 的生命周期包括创建、运行、终止或删除几个阶段:创建阶段:Pod 被创建后,会被赋予一个唯一的 ID。Pod 的状态通过 PodStatus 对象管理,其中包含一个 phase 字段,初始状态可能为 Pending,表示 Pod 正在被调度。

4、Pod生命周期是从创建到终止的整个过程,包括以下几个关键阶段和状态:创建阶段:客户提交Pod创建请求api Server。API Server生成存储Pod的资源信息。调度器为Pod分配节点。Kubelet在分配的节点上启动容器,并向API Server报告状态。初始化容器运行:在主容器启动前,初始化容器按顺序执行

5、Pod 的生命周期包括创建、运行、终止或删除。Pod 被创建后,会被赋予一个唯一的 ID(UID)并被调度到节点。节点失效时,Pod 也会被计划删除。Pod 自身不具有自愈能力,当被调度到失效节点或因资源耗尽、节点维护被驱逐时,会被删除。Pod 实例由控制器管理,以应对随时可能丢弃的特性。

6、Pod生命周期预设为从Pending阶段开始,只要至少一个主要容器启动成功,Pod状态进入Running。Pod状态取决于容器是否失败状态结束,最终可能为Succeeded或Failed。Kubernetes监控Pod中每个容器状态,容器状态有三种。当容器配置了prestop回调,则在容器进入Terminated状态前执行此回调。

Pod的生命周期

Pod是Kubernetes中最小的可部署计算单元,它封装了一个或多个容器以及这些容器的一些共享资源。Pod的生命周期从创建开始,经历运行、更新、终止等阶段,直到最终被删除。

Pod生命周期是指Pod对象从创建至终止的这段时间范围内所经历的一系列过程和状态变化。它主要包括Pod的创建过程、运行过程(包括初始化容器、主容器、容器启动钩子和容器终止前钩子)、容器探测(存活性探测和就绪性探测)以及Pod的终止过程。

pod生命周期证书(ipd生命周期阶段主要活动)

Pod 的生命周期包括创建、运行、终止或删除几个阶段:创建阶段:Pod 被创建后,会被赋予一个唯一的 ID。Pod 的状态通过 PodStatus 对象管理,其中包含一个 phase 字段,初始状态可能为 Pending,表示 Pod 正在被调度。

Pod 的生命周期包括创建、运行、终止或删除。Pod 被创建后,会被赋予一个唯一的 ID(UID)并被调度到节点。节点失效时,Pod 也会被计划删除。Pod 自身不具有自愈能力,当被调度到失效节点或因资源耗尽、节点维护被驱逐时,会被删除。Pod 实例由控制器管理,以应对随时可能丢弃的特性。

Pod生命周期预设为从Pending阶段开始,只要至少一个主要容器启动成功,Pod状态进入Running。Pod状态取决于容器是否以失败状态结束,最终可能为Succeeded或Failed。Kubernetes监控Pod中每个容器状态,容器状态有三种。当容器配置了preStop回调,则在容器进入Terminated状态前执行此回调。

Pod生命周期是从创建到终止的整个过程,包括以下几个关键阶段和状态:创建阶段:客户端提交Pod创建请求到API Server。API Server生成并存储Pod的资源信息。调度器为Pod分配节点。Kubelet在分配的节点上启动容器,并向API Server报告状态。初始化容器运行:在主容器启动前,初始化容器按顺序执行。

返回列表
上一篇:
下一篇: